Obituary of Dorothy Kuller
Dorothy Kuller
Dorothy was born on May 18, 1934 to John W and Margaret M Kuller in Prattsburgh, NY. Dorothy had a long and successful career at the working at Sibley, Lindsey and Curr in Rochester, NY as a secretary to buyers. Most weekends, she would leave the city and drive to her parents home on Keuka Lake. There, she would usually be visited by her brother John and his family for a fun filled weekend of boating and swimming. In her retirement, Dorothy lived a quiet life enjoying sewing, decoupage, and puzzles. She crocheted many baby blankets which she donated to local charities. She was a great friend and neighbor enjoying distributing mail at her condominium. Her sharp wit and humor will be sorely missed. Dorothy leaves behind her brother John (Betty) of Portland, OR and nephews Bruce (Bernadette) of Rockingham, VA and James (Nancy) Kuller of Happy Valley, OR. All mourn her passing.
